About >> Advisory Committee

The Duke Forest Advisory Committee comprises a cross-section of disciplines and interests across the University. The committee provides advice and direction both in general terms for the Forest's future and with reference to specific problems and issues. The committee is chaired by the dean of the Nicholas School of the Environment & Earth Sciences and meets on an irregular basis normally at the request of the Forest's resource manager.

Current members of the Duke Forest Advisory Committee are:

Bill Chameides, Dean of the Nicholas School of the Environment - Chair

Emily Bernhardt, Assistant Professor of Biogeochemistry

Norm Christensen, Professor of Ecology and Founding Dean of the Nicholas School

Pat Halpin, Gabel Associate Professor of the Practice of Marine Geospatial Ecology

Ken Knoerr, Professor Emeritus of Environmental Meteorology and Hydrology

Bill Morris, Professor of Biology

Ram Oren, Professor of Ecology and Chair, Environmental Science and Policy Division of the Nicholas School

Dan Richter, Professor of Soils and Forest Ecology

John Simon, Vice Provost for Academic Affairs and George B. Geller Professor, Department of Chemistry

David Singleton, Associate University Counsel

David Stein, Senior Program Coordinator for Community Affairs
